Definition
WRETCHEDLY: in a manner that expresses deep sorrow, misery, or poor performance.

Wretchedly sentence examples
- She wretchedly mourned the loss of her beloved pet.
- The team played wretchedly, failing to score a single point in the match.
- He spoke wretchedly about his past, filled with regrets and missed opportunities.
- After the storm passed, the town was left wretchedly devastated and in need of help.
- She wretchedly realized that her dreams had been overshadowed by her fears.
